Bill Summary
Provides that definition of minority business enterprise include persons of Middle Eastern and North African descent for State certification and assistance purposes; revises definition for school board and local government contract set-aside purposes.
AI Summary
This bill amends the definition of "minority business enterprise" to include businesses that are at least 51% owned and controlled by persons of Middle Eastern and North African descent for the purposes of state certification and assistance programs. It also revises the definition of "minority group members" used for school board and local government contract set-aside purposes to include those of Middle Eastern and North African descent.
